Output efc648dfb3f1aa48aa3c9d3b7fd08839a12fea34a4bcafd36ed475d2be324674:8

value
2153300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1db3dde0a1868bd618b23a58c5be0d8b86fa169e OP_EQUAL
address
34Q4zTv3RnWFf6s8MjP7GvVAXwfYE7YaqY
transaction
efc648dfb3f1aa48aa3c9d3b7fd08839a12fea34a4bcafd36ed475d2be324674
spent
true